Originally Posted By NickDigger
Plateau Power: Thanks for the recommend on the Kelty. I actually already have a Kelty Red Wing 50, and am looking for something a little smaller and a little lighter for extended hikes. My Red Wing has been great, and I have the Kelty Tannen backpack for every day use as well.
Yeah I have Redwing 50 as my truck bag, it's a bit large for anything less than a 3 day. My favorite day hike pack is a larger size camel back pack. It's really light and just big enough to fit water, snacks, etc for my kids.

https://smile.amazon.com/dp/B004NX44...ing=UTF8&psc=1

I have several of these bags too. They are pretty good. I have one loaded up with predator hunting stuff, and another I use for archery hunting. They are big enough to actually carry stuff, but will cinch down pretty small when not fully loaded. Lots of pockets to keep stuff organized. The only thing I don't like about the SOC is it doesn't have a rigid support so you have to load it so nothing is causing it to ride weird.
